What are stray dogs called in the Caribbean?

“Potcake” is the name of the feral dogs from the Caribbean Islands. The name originates from the Bahamas and the Turks & Caicos Islands. They were dubbed with this name because the locals used to feed stray dogs the caked on remains of the cooking pot from their dish called “rice and peas”.

Are Potcakes hypoallergenic?

Potcake dogs of the Bahamas have short fur with little to no undercoat. They have

smooth coats

that need little grooming other than the occasional brush. Potcakes, however, are not hypoallergenic and will shed.

Are there crocodiles in Dominican Republic?

Lake Enriquillo in the Dominican Republic is one of few saltwater lakes known to support a population of crocodiles Some say it is the only saltwater lake that does. The crocodiles are ideally suited to Enriquillo’s water, which has a high salt content, sometimes reaching 100 parts per thousand.

Why can’t pugs fly on planes?

In addition, many airlines have banned brachycephalic breeds—short-nosed animals such as pugs, bulldogs, Shih-tzus, and Persian cats—from flying in cargo holds because their unusual nose and airway anatomy make it harder for them to breathe, a condition known as Brachycephalic Airway Syndrome.

Why are they banning pugs?

Animal welfare organisations have been pushing for a ban on the breeding of brachycephalic pets in recent years, claiming that they can develop serious health problems These puppies can suffer from breathing problems, hyperthermia, sleep apnea, eye disease, and other severe illnesses.
